首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当两个行号相同时选择值

,是指在数据库中存在多个具有相同行号的记录时,如何选择其中的某个记录。

在数据库中,每个记录都有一个唯一的标识符,称为行号或行标识符。当多个记录具有相同的行号时,可能会导致数据冲突或混乱。为了解决这个问题,可以使用以下几种方法来选择值:

  1. 根据特定条件选择:可以根据某些特定条件来选择值,例如选择最新的记录、选择最大或最小的值、选择满足某些条件的记录等。具体的选择条件取决于业务需求和数据的特点。
  2. 使用唯一标识符选择:如果每个记录都有一个唯一的标识符,可以使用该标识符来选择值。唯一标识符可以是自增长的数字、全局唯一的字符串等。通过使用唯一标识符,可以确保选择的记录是唯一的。
  3. 使用时间戳选择:如果记录包含时间戳信息,可以根据时间戳来选择值。可以选择最新的记录或在某个时间范围内的记录。时间戳可以是记录创建时间、更新时间或其他相关时间信息。
  4. 使用其他属性选择:根据记录的其他属性来选择值,例如选择某个特定用户的记录、选择某个特定地区的记录等。根据业务需求和数据特点,选择合适的属性进行筛选。

腾讯云相关产品和产品介绍链接地址:

  • 云数据库 TencentDB:提供高性能、可扩展的云数据库服务,支持多种数据库引擎,满足不同业务需求。详细信息请参考:腾讯云数据库 TencentDB
  • 云服务器 CVM:提供弹性、安全、可靠的云服务器实例,支持多种操作系统和应用场景。详细信息请参考:腾讯云服务器 CVM
  • 云原生容器服务 TKE:提供高度可扩展的容器化应用管理平台,支持容器部署、弹性伸缩、负载均衡等功能。详细信息请参考:腾讯云原生容器服务 TKE

请注意,以上仅为腾讯云的部分产品示例,具体选择适合的产品应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 推荐算法理论与实践(差代码) 原

    买过一些商品并且进行了评分,因此具备该用户信息,以便推荐 但是新用户并没有,这就是冷启动 6.基于内容的推荐的优缺点 7.基于协同过滤的推荐的优缺点 gray sheep 当没有相似的时候...,无法推荐 shiling attack:被刷分影响 8.混合算法 mixed:使用多个推荐系统同时进行推荐,将推荐结果同时推送给用户 feature combination...选择A/Btesing的方式来选择推荐系统 评估方式结合CTR,CR,ROI,QA来进行综合评估 最后的到可靠的推荐系统 三、电影推荐系统实践(线下评估方式) 1.基于矩阵分解的电影推荐系统...必须进行处理 处理是0的部分 两个矩阵初始化,对两个矩阵相乘,transpose_b=True对第二个矩阵转置。...行1和行2相加 这里将正则化项拉姆达设置为1,可以通过调整拉姆达来看模型性能的变化 le-4是10的-4次方 (4)训练模型 第一个参数loss是对要可视化变量起名,第二个

    82930

    面试|海量文本去重~minhash

    当数据量大的时候,计算的时间和空间复杂度就会是一个很重要的问题,比如在推断相似发帖的时候。我们能够用kmeans来进行聚类。可是资源的消耗是巨大的。...所以我索性用行号来代表term,行号跟term是一一相应的。比如 ? 第一行中的S1,、S2、S3表示文档,第一列的01234表示行号。也即单词。...最好保证hash后的值均匀。比如x+1mod5,3x+1mod5。我们选用这两个hash函数来产生行号的顺序。看一下我们如今的情况 ?...我们用h1、h2两个hash函数产生了两个行号顺序,那么接下来就是关键步骤了 比如求文档s1的值。遍历s1相应的单词 从第0行到第四行 1. 第0行为1,看一下h1计算出来的行号为1。...为什么minhash的方法是合理的 问题:两个集合的随机的一个行排列的minhash值相等的概率和两个集合的Jaccard相似度相等 证明例如以下: 两个集合。A、B。对一行来说。

    2.8K30

    Python GDAL绘制遥感影像时间序列曲线

    我们希望分别针对这三个文件夹中的多张遥感影像数据,随机绘制部分像元对应的时间序列曲线图(每一个像元对应一张曲线图,一张曲线图中有三条曲线);每一张曲线图的最终结果都是如下所示的类似的样式,X轴表示时间节点,Y轴就是具体的像素值。...original_file_path路径下的所有栅格遥感影像文件,在基于gdal.Open()函数将这一文件下的第一景遥感影像打开后,获取其行数与列数;随后,通过np.random.randint()函数生成两个随机数数组...,分别对应着后期我们绘图的像元的行号与列号。   ...我们前面选择好了50个随机位置的像元,此时就可以遍历这些像元,对每一个像元在不同时相中的数值加以读取——通过.ReadAsArray()函数将栅格图像各波段的信息读取为Array格式,并通过对应的行号与列号加以像素值的获取...;随后,将获取得到的像元在不同时相的数值通过.append()函数依次放入前面新生成的列表中。

    37410

    FPGA Verilog-1995 VS Verilog-2001

    2001年3月IEEE正式批准了Verilog‐2001标准(IEEE1364‐2001),与Verilog‐1995相比主要有以下提高。...8、乘方运算符 增加乘方运算(power operate),运算符是**,如果其中有一个操作数是real类型的,返回值将是real类型。...两个操作数都是integer类型,返回才是integer类型。 ? 9、自动(可重入)任务和自动(递归)函数 (1).可重入任务 任务本质上是静态的,同时并发执行的多个任务共享存储区。...当某个任务在模块中的多个地方被同时调用,则这两个任务对同一块地址空间进行操作,结果可能是错误的。Verilog‐2001中增加了关键字automatic,内存空间是动态分配的,使任务成为可重入的。...但如果Verilog代码经过其他工具的处理,源码的行号和文件名可能丢失。故在Verilog‐2001中增加了`line,用来标定源码的行号和文件名。

    1.6K50

    深入内存主存:解剖DRAM存储器

    图一:DRAM 基本单元 当要读取 cell 的存储值,首先打开电子开关(即晶体管),然后根据电容的充放电信息获得存储值。...之后放大器把暂存的数据送到选择器,同时列地址也会被送到选择器,选择器根据列地址把数据中的某一位送到输出线。 输出数据之后,还要把单元行数据写回。...总的来说, 读取一个比特的总体流程是:获得行号,译码行号,开启单元行,放大位线电压波动并暂存数据到放大器,获得列号并根据列号选择一位进行输出,写回数据,关闭字线,重新预充电。...而写一个比特的总体流程是:获得行号,译码行号,开启单元行,放大位线电压波动并暂存数据到放大器,获得列号并输入写入数据,根据列号把写入数据送到放大器并改写暂存值,写回数据,关闭字线,重新预充电。...这 8 颗芯片被一个内存通道同时访问,所以它们合称为一个 rank 。有的 DIMM 条有两面,即两面都有内存芯片,这种 DIMM 条拥有两个 rank 。

    1.9K34

    Excel公式技巧27: 在条件格式中使用公式来突出显示单元格

    选择“使用公式确定要设置格式的单元格” 2. 在“为符合此公式的值设置格式”框中输入适当的公式 3. 单击“格式”按钮,设置想要的格式。 ? 图1 本文以交替突出显示所选单元格区域颜色为例来讲解。...图3 可以清楚地看到,公式中ROW()返回当前单元格所在行的行号;MOD(ROW(),2)返回行号除以2后的余数,要么是0(偶数行),要么是1(奇数行);将MOD(ROW(),2)与0相比较:MOD(ROW...(),2)=0,返回值TRUE/FALSE。...图7 我们知道,偶数+偶数=偶数、偶数+奇数=奇数,而相邻行列号相加应该为奇数,因此,我们可以判断相邻行号相加的奇偶性来确定是否设置单元格格式。...Excel提供了函数IsOdd和函数IsEven来判断奇偶性,返回的值是True/False。

    3.3K20

    Landsat系列卫星全球参考系统,指定的PATH和ROW编号详细介绍

    当卫星沿着它的路径移动时,观测站的仪器不断地扫描下面的地形。仪器的信号被传送到地球上,并与遥测星历数据相关联,以形成单个框架图像。在这个过程中,连续数据被分割成单独的数据帧,称为场景。...大地卫星1-3号的场景中心是以航天器的时间为单位,从赤道的任何一个方向选择的,每个场景相当于地球表面的大约163公里(101英里),加上地面处理器增加的大约10%的轨道内重叠(大地卫星3号为5%)。...路径号和行号的组合可以唯一地识别一个名义上的场景中心。路径号总是先给出,然后是行号。例如,127-043这个符号与路径号127和行号043有关。...Landsat 1-3的每一天的覆盖都与前一天的覆盖相重叠。这构成了一个完整的覆盖周期,由251个轨道组成,正好需要18天,提供了北纬82度和南纬82度之间的完整全球覆盖。...Landsats 4、5、7、8(以及即将到来的9)的地球覆盖范围与Landsats 1-3相似。然而,较低的高度导致了不同的扫描模式。

    37510

    关于单元格区域,99%的用户都不知道的事儿

    如下图3,将两个单元格区域内的值相加,就好像只有一个单个区域一样。 图3 并且,在一些场景中,联合运算符有更大的能力,如下图4所示,使用AVERAGE函数来查找单元格区域B2:B7的平均值。...图4 图4单元格E2中的公式查找:如果下一个值是9,平均值是多少? 交叉运算符 交叉运算符是空格符,如下图5所示。 图5 结果为10,因为这两个单元格区域在单元格C4相交,所以返回其值10。...当将其应用于命名区域时,可以创建一个简单的查找公式而不需要任何函数。 如下图6所示,已根据第1行和第A列为对应的列和行命名。现在,可以使用交叉运算符创建查找。示例中返回的值是7。...INDIRECT INDIRECT函数接受文本字符串并将其转换成单元格区域,例如: =INDIRECT(“A” & F2) 公式中,单元格F2中是一个代表行号的数字,如果F2中的值是3,那么单元格引用就是...图11 实际上,这个公式就是求单元格区域B2:E5中的值之和,即: =SUM(B2:E5) CHOOSE CHOOSE可用于基于索引值选择不同的单元格区域,如下图12所示。

    24420

    linux中vim如何显示行数,vim 在linux下中如何设置显示行数「建议收藏」

    softtabstop:表示在编辑模式的时候按退格键的时候退回缩进的长度,当使用 expandtab 时特别有用。...当设置成 expandtab 时,缩进用空格来表示noexpandtab 则是用制表符表示一个缩进。....在程序编译出错时,一般会提示出错的行号,但是用vim打开的代码确不显示行号,错误语句的定位非常不便.那么怎 … Linux下环境变量设置 (转) Linux下环境变量设置 1.在Windows 系统下...*:矩阵你元素一对一相乘 (dot) 例子: >> a=[2 3];>> b=[4 5];>> a*b’ ans = 23 > … chrome 下载插件包及离线安装 最近需要测试http rest服务...a:b) #define Min(a,b) (a WebService/WCF/WebAPI区别 详细描述它们之间的区别,为什么这么选择,尤其是WCF vs WebAPI 11&period

    6.6K20

    不会乘法表怎么做乘法?这个远古的算法竟然可以!

    表8 半/倍表 第八部分 设置半列的行号第一行是 0,最后一行是 6,可以看到半列值为奇数的行号是 0、 3、4、6。现在,请注意这个关键模式:这些行号恰好是 89 的表达式中的指数。...这不是巧合;我们构造半列的方式意味着这个2的幂之和表达式中的指数,恰好总是奇数值的行号。把这些行对应的倍列值相加,其实就是18乘以2的幂之和,这个幂之和刚好等于89,即18和89。...假设我们要把两个数 n1和 n2相乘,首先,打开 一个 Python 脚本,定义以下变量: n1 = 89n2 = 18 接下来,开始处理半列。...这个循环的每次迭代,是将上一个值乘以2添加到倍列,当倍列的长度与半列的长度相等时停止: doubling = [n2]while(len(doubling) 值是奇数的行: half_double = half_double.loc[half_double[0]%2 == 1,:] 这里使用pandas模块的loc函数选择想要的行

    1.6K30

    解析大型.NET ERP系统 20条数据库设计规范

    当系统越来越庞大,严格控制数据库的设计人员,并且有一份规范书供执行参考。在程序框架中,也有一份强制性的约定,当不遵守规范时报错误。...RefNo是字符串类型,可用于单据编码功能中自动填写单据流水号,从表的EntryNo是行号,LineNo是SQL Server 的关键字,所以用EntryNo作为行号。...10 多货币(本位币)转换字段的设计 金额或单价默认是以日记帐中的货币为记录,当默认货币与本位币不同时需要同时记录下本位币的值。...当手工创建一张出仓单时,将DirectEntry设为true,表示可编辑单据中的字段值,当由其它单据传递产生过来产生的出仓单,将DirectEntry设为false,表示不能编辑此单据。...文件的MD5相当于文件的唯一识别身份,在网上下载文件时,网站常常会放出文件的MD5值,以方便对比核对。

    2.5K70

    Chrome设置断点的各种姿势

    在打开的页面上单击对应的行号即可设置断点。 同时也可以通过在行号上右键点击Add breakpoint来设置断点。...当一个表达式跨行时,添加的断点会默认下移到该表达式结束后的一行 ? 在JavaScript代码中设置条件断点 当知道了如何在行号上单击来添加断点,已经能满足最最最基本的调试了。...我们可以通过右键行号,选择Add conditional breakpoint来添加一个带有条件的断点。 ?...禁用断点的方式,选择菜单栏中的Disable breakpoint 或者直接在设置了断点的行号上单击即可。 或者我们也可以通过debugger模块来统一管理所有的断点。...点击➕新增一个断点,我们可以选择输入一个链接地址,当一个XHR请求的链接与所输入的值匹配时,便会中断进程进入断点。 ? 或者我们可以选择直接回车,监听所有的XHR请求 ?

    16.1K80

    如何利用锁存器做一个寄存器 和 内存?

    图示:当A输入0时,AND的结果为0,B也为0.之后不管A如何变化,输出将永远为0同样也是持久化的存储了之后就不会改变 图片 AND-OR锁存器 现在我们把上面的两个存储电路结合起来做成一个有用的存储:...当SET为1时他锁住了这个1 锁存介绍 重点:当SET为1RESET=0时他锁住了这个1(即SET不管如何变化最后的结果永远都是1)。...;当设置为0时,不会影响数据的输出。...图片 如何实现只打开某个锁存器 首先给定行号和列号,只有对应的行号和列号都满足条件时,才会打开某个锁存器的行列选择器 (ROW+COLUMN SELECT TEST)。...转换示例:比如行号12用二进制表示:1100,列号8用二进制表示:1000.因此行列的表示可以写成11001000代表的是十二行第8列 选择多路复用器 根据转换的不同行列数,需要不同的多路复用器。

    51820

    hive基础总结(面试常用)

    三种分组的区别 row_number:不管col2字段的值是否相等,行号一直递增,比如:有两条记录的值相等,但一个是第一,一个是第二 rank:上下两条记录的col2相等时,记录的行号是一样的...,但下一个col2值的行号递增N(N是重复的次数),比如:有两条并列第一,下一个是第三,没有第二 dense_rank:上下两条记录的col2相等时,下一个col2值的行号递增1,比如:有两条并列第一...可以在空值前面加随机散列 3种常见的join Map-side Join mapJoin的主要意思就是,当链接的两个表是一个比较小的表和一个特别大的表的时候,我们把比较小的table直接放到内存中去,...看看下面的两个表格的连接。...***reduce side join是一种最简单的join方式,其主要思想如下: 在map阶段,map函数同时读取两个文件File1和File2,为了区分两种来源的key/value数据对,对每条数据打一个标签

    76730

    使用锁存器做一个寄存器 和 内存

    图示:当A输入0时,AND的结果为0,B也为0.之后不管A如何变化,输出将永远为0 同样也是持久化的存储了之后就不会改变 AND-OR锁存器 现在我们把上面的两个存储电路结合起来做成一个有用的存储...当SET为1时他锁住了这个1 锁存介绍 重点:当SET为1RESET=0时他锁住了这个1(即SET不管如何变化最后的结果永远都是1)。...;当设置为0时,不会影响数据的输出。...如何实现只打开某个锁存器 首先给定行号和列号,只有对应的行号和列号都满足条件时,才会打开某个锁存器的行列选择器 (ROW+COLUMN SELECT TEST)。...转换示例:比如行号12用二进制表示:1100,列号8用二进制表示:1000.因此行列的表示可以写成11001000代表的是十二行第8列 选择多路复用器 根据转换的不同行列数,需要不同的多路复用器。

    75221

    Mysql引擎介绍及InnoDB逻辑存储结构

    因为是存在内存中,所以数据访问的速度一般也要快于其它存储引擎,同时Memory支持Hash索引,因此在单值查找的速度非常快。...这里分别取两个最常操作的update和select操作大致描述一下内部的流转机制(在默认的可重复读级别下, 同时略去了所有有关加锁释放锁的操作): 1.select * from xxx where id...同时我们也可以看到,InnoDB结构图中5.7相对与5.5最大的变化,就是对于ibdata1的拆分,它把原本共享表空间,undo表空间和临时表空间从ibdata1中分了出来。...这两种数据组织形式,使得下面两种引擎有如下区别: 1.由于使用聚簇索引,所以无法同时把数据行存放在两个地方,所以一个表只能有一个聚簇索引。...另外,如果在二级索引上存储的是实际数据的行号,那在数据页调整的时候,也要对这些二级索引进行更新,这同时也会导致写性能的下降。 InnoDB的行锁和间隙锁 ?

    57720

    Mysql引擎介绍及InnoDB逻辑存储结构

    因为是存在内存中,所以数据访问的速度一般也要快于其它存储引擎,同时Memory支持Hash索引,因此在单值查找的速度非常快。...这里分别取两个最常操作的update和select操作大致描述一下内部的流转机制(在默认的可重复读级别下, 同时略去了所有有关加锁释放锁的操作): 1.select * from xxx where id...同时我们也可以看到,InnoDB结构图中5.7相对与5.5最大的变化,就是对于ibdata1的拆分,它把原本共享表空间,undo表空间和临时表空间从ibdata1中分了出来。...这两种数据组织形式,使得下面两种引擎有如下区别: 1.由于使用聚簇索引,所以无法同时把数据行存放在两个地方,所以一个表只能有一个聚簇索引。...另外,如果在二级索引上存储的是实际数据的行号,那在数据页调整的时候,也要对这些二级索引进行更新,这同时也会导致写性能的下降。

    51510
    领券